Output 33cd6c9bf0c254053f336a8c6f79e5db155b2e45a9cc872307decd69d01bd103:1

value
603860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08484590857e16b7ec372484ac0c6803b5be0e55 OP_EQUAL
address
32Souc98KNcmvPEWddBbsejQHFM5ZCvQUG
transaction
33cd6c9bf0c254053f336a8c6f79e5db155b2e45a9cc872307decd69d01bd103
confirmations
342680
spent
true